Vancouver island camping. We think French Beach Provincial Park offers the best Vancouver Island Camping to explore day hikes along the Juan de Fuca Trail. Just a short drive away, you will find China Beach, Mystic Beach, Sombrio Beach, Sandcut Beach, and the incredible tidal pools at Botanical Beach at the far end of the Juan de Fuca Trail.

Home; Facilities; Vancouver Island is the largest island on the west coast of North America. It stretches 460 kilometers (290 miles) from tip to tip, extends 100 kilometers (62 miles) at its widest point and covers 32,134 km² (12,407 sq miles). The island is part of the Western Cordillera a partially submerged chain and extension of the US Coastal Mountains. Sombrio Beach (Juan de …Strathcona Park, designated in 1911, is the oldest park in British Columbia. Located almost in the centre of Vancouver Island, Strathcona Park is a rugged mountain wilderness comprising of more than 250,000 hectares. Mountain peaks, some perpetually mantled with snow, dominate the park.Cape Scott Trail, Vancouver Island: Complete Hiking Guide. Watch this video on YouTube.Feb 4, 2024 · SMONEĆTEN (McDonald) Campground. This 49-site forested campground is located near the Swartz Bay ferry terminal on Vancouver Island’s Saanich Peninsula. SMONEĆTEN (McDonald) Campground is part of Gulf Islands National Park Reserve. It’s a quick drive to the town of Sidney or you can bike the nearby Lochside Trail.
